The Mossberg 535 ATS Turkey/Deer Combo LPA Trigger Pump 12 Ga 3.5″ 22″XXF/ is a versatile, dual-barrel pump-action shotgun combo chambered for 12-gauge 3.5″ shells. It comes with a 22″ extra-full turkey barrel and a 24″ rifled deer barrel with cantilever scope mount, allowing hunters to effectively pursue both game types with one reliable firearm platform. This setup is a classic budget-conscious choice for maximizing hunting opportunities.

Here’s the thing—the real value isn’t just in getting two barrels; it’s in the thoughtful pairing. The 22″ turkey barrel is ported and features an extra-full choke tube, delivering the tight patterns needed for ethical turkey harvests at reasonable ranges. The 24″ fully rifled deer barrel, with its integrated cantilever scope mount, is a game-changer for slug accuracy. You can mount a scope like a Vortex Crossfire or a Bushnell Banner directly to the barrel, ensuring zero stays true when you swap barrels. No gunsmithing required for the swap, either—it’s a simple, tool-less operation that takes seconds.

At its core, you’re getting Mossberg’s proven 535 action. This pump is built to handle the potent 3.5″ magnum loads for turkeys or waterfowl, but it’ll also cycle lighter 2.75″ target loads for practice. The LPA (Lightning Pump Action) trigger is a standout feature, offering a cleaner, crisper pull than many budget pumps. The synthetic stock is durable and weather-resistant, and the overall package weighs in at a manageable 7.5 pounds, making it easy to carry through a long day in the field. Specification Detail
Gauge / Chamber 12 Gauge / 3.5″
Barrel 1 (Turkey) 22″, Ported, XX-Full Choke Tube
Barrel 2 (Deer) 24″, Fully Rifled, Cantilever Scope Mount
Action Pump Action (LPA Trigger)
Capacity 4+1 Rounds
Overall Weight Approx. 7.5 lbs

Pros: Exceptional value for a two-purpose hunting tool. The cantilever scope mount on the rifled barrel is a major accuracy advantage. Handles the full range of 12-gauge shells. The LPA trigger is a genuine upgrade. Simple, rugged Mossberg reliability you can count on.

Cons: The synthetic stock is functional but not fancy. The 22″ turkey barrel can feel a bit short for some waterfowl applications. As a combo, it’s a jack-of-all-trades, master-of-none compared to dedicated, high-end turkey or deer guns—but that’s the tradeoff for the price.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Can I use the rifled deer barrel for anything other than slugs?

A: No. A fully rifled barrel is designed specifically for sabot slugs, which are required for accuracy and safety. Never shoot shot, buckshot, or standard foster slugs through a rifled barrel.

Q: What scope works with the cantilever mount?

A: The mount uses standard one-inch rings. Most hunting scopes in the 1-4x, 2-7x, or 3-9x range from brands like Vortex, Leupold, or Nikon (when they were available) are compatible and ideal for slug distances.

Q: Is the turkey barrel threaded for other chokes?

A: Yes. The 22″ barrel uses common Mossberg Accu-Choke threads (compatible with many aftermarket tubes from brands like Carlson’s or Trulock), allowing you to swap the included XX-Full for Modified or Improved Cylinder chokes for other game if needed.
